Job Description

As a seasoned HR professional, you will be responsible for acting as a business partner and overseeing all HR functions for the Auto Component Business. Your primary objective will be to drive results and implement strategies that align with the organization's goals and policies. Your role will involve managing the entire spectrum of HR, Industrial Relations (IR), Learning & Development (L&D), Administration, Performance, and Talent. Your key responsibilities will include developing talent strategies, conducting manpower planning and budgeting, and aligning HR strategies with the business unit's objectives. You will be tasked with implementing group HR and IR policies, leading digital transformation and automation of HR processes, and managing the entire employee life cycle from recruitment to performance management. Collaborating with business function heads, you will draft and implement workforce planning strategies to ensure efficient staffing and optimal employee performance. You will also be responsible for talent and performance management, including identifying high-potential employees, developing career succession plans, and driving organizational initiatives related to talent management. Additionally, you will liaise with local authorities and union representatives to ensure smooth operations, resolve grievances, and drive proactive industrial relations practices. Furthermore, you will play a crucial role in learning and development by implementing strategies aligned with the Group's philosophy, identifying training needs, and evaluating the effectiveness of training programs. Your expertise in HR management, business acumen, knowledge of labor laws and IR policies, result orientation, analytical thinking, and conflict resolution skills will be key to your success in this role. Your educational qualifications should include an MSW/MBA in Human Resource Management or Personnel & IR Management, along with a minimum of 20 years of HR experience, preferably in manufacturing organizations. Your location of work will be Gurgaon or Faridabad. Overall, your role as an HR professional in this position will be critical in driving business efficiency, ensuring compliance with statutory requirements, fostering positive employer-employee relationships, and enhancing employee engagement and satisfaction levels.,
